| Name: | dizocilpine | 
|---|---|
| Synonyms: | (+)-dizocilpine, (+)-MK-801, (5S,10R)-5-methyl-10,11-dihydro-5H-5,10-epiminodibenzo[a,d][7]annulene, dizocilpina, dizocilpine, dizocilpinum, MK 801, MK-801, MK801 | 
| Definition: | An organic heterotetracyclic compound that is 1-methyl-8-azabicyclo[3.2.1]octane ortho-fused to two benzene rings at positions 2-3 and 6-7 (the 5S,10R-stereoisomer). It is a non-competitive antagonist of the N-methyl-D-aspartate (NMDA) receptor and affects cognitive function, learning, and memory. |
